> Tinderbox has long since been replaced by the TBPL (Tinderbox pushlog -
> which doesn't use tinderbox despite the name). More recently the tbpl
> has been replaced by treeherder - at least for Firefox and Thunderbird.
>
> So Tinderbox is about two generations ago.
